DESCRIPTION:The Falling and the Rising is an operatic story of service and sacrifice\, which traces the inner journey of a soldier who enters a coma after she suffers a roadside attack. As the soldier moves through her unconscious dreamscape\, the audience will serve as both companion and witness\, sharing powerful encounters with fellow service members along the way. \nThis opera centers around a strong female hero known only as “Soldier.” After sending a video message home on the eve of her daughter’s thirteenth birthday\, Soldier is severely wounded by a roadside bomb. As she experiences a medically-induced coma\, she sees visions of other soldiers’ stories\, each on their journey toward healing and home. \nBased on real-life interviews with wounded soldiers at Walter Reed Hospital\, this Soldier’s odyssey was created to honor the indomitable spirit of our U.S. Military veterans. By shedding light on the inspirational power of their stories\, Arizona Opera hopes to knit the civilian and veteran/military populations together through this story of family\, service\, sacrifice\, and hope. \nTHE FALLING AND THE RISING was conceived by Sergeant First Class Benjamin Hilgert. THE FALLING AND THE RISING was originally commissioned by the US Army Field Band and Soldiers Chorus\, Opera Memphis\, Seattle Opera\, San Diego Opera\, Arizona Opera\, and TCU. THE FALLING AND THE RISING was originally workshopped at Seagle Music Colony. DESCRIPTION:Our 2022-23 season opens with a collection of landmark works that showcase the spectacular sounds of the full orchestra with Virginia G. Piper Music Director Tito Muñoz and virtuosa violinist Sarah Chang. Ms. Chang makes her much anticipated return with a performance of Bruch’s Violin Concerto No. 1 – one of the world’s most beloved violin concerti.
